National Art Honor Society Gives Back

Cookie Exchange

by Irene Thraen-Borowski

On December 14, 2011, NAHS members met after school to make cookies to solicit donations for non-perusable food items and winter clothing.  NAHS members made over 160 cookies and each one was uniquely decorated.

For the next two days, AVC students could buy a cookie for $.50 or bring in a canned food item or winter clothing item in exchange for a cookie.  Many AVC students brought in multiple items and were rewarded with multiple cookies.

The National Art Honor Society received approximately 30 food items, 3 winter coats, 2 hats, multiple pairs of gloves, and 2 scarves.  These items have been donated to local food pantries, while the money raised will go toward the AVC National Art Honor Society chapter.  Everyone agreed the event was a success and a fun way to give back.  

 

Special thanks to Mrs. Moon for allowing the NAHS chapter to use her classroom for cookie assembly, as well as the home school bus drivers for always supporting our events.
